Output 4db31005686ccdcc3786b81507200c9a2d1c935d4863c3d5d1735d9bb0c46e74:18

value
8447220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 45fb5fa3a0d790cf788df5701e3623e8cb6b4360cc838b6ef685fc4389047c12
address
tb1pgha4lgaq67gv77yd74cpud3rar9kksmqejpckmhksh7y8zgy0sfqnyyt27
transaction
4db31005686ccdcc3786b81507200c9a2d1c935d4863c3d5d1735d9bb0c46e74
confirmations
16889
spent
true